00:00I'm just wondering about another development that we found out about in the last day or
00:05so. The White House confirming that direct talks are taking place with Hamas, which I
00:10think is unprecedented. Correct me if I'm wrong. Do you think that's something that's
00:14likely to worry the Israeli leadership?
00:17It is worrying because it's a form of recognition, maybe legitimization, if external powers,
00:28particularly a superpower, it is directly with a terrorist organization. It does give
00:34that organization a certain kind of legitimacy. And it's awkward for Israelis. Israel does
00:41not want to see that. But the White House attitude on this is a familiar trend or strand
00:50of American pragmatism. If you don't give me results on other tracks, then I will try
00:56the direct track. And if you don't like it that much, then too bad.
